Wilmington Fire Department broke ground on a new station
WILMINGTON, NC (WWAY) — Nearly 3.5 million dollars and seven years later, Wilmington Fire Department finally broke ground on a new station this morning.
Wilmington’s Mayor, Bill Saffo and Fire Chief, Buddy Martinette spoke during the ceremony before breaking ground.
This new station will replace stations five and six. The new facility will be updated and will be able to accommodate larger fire trucks.
The Fire Chief said this location was strategically planned.
“This is an awesome accomplishment for the city. What people need to understand is this is the final piece of a puzzle that reduced our number of facilities, but also still provided the same level of protection for our citizens. Ultimately this saved 10 million dollars in this plan,” Fire Chief Martinette said.
The new station will be located on Shipyard Boulevard beside the Family Dollar store. Construction is expected to start in June.
